Marick Name Meaning

Americanized form of Czech Mařík (see Marik ). Americanized form of Serbian and Croatian Marić Slovenian Marič (see Maric ).

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Marick family from?

You can see how Marick families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Marick family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Marick families were found in USA in 1920. In 1840 there was 1 Marick family living in Georgia. This was about 50% of all the recorded Marick's in USA. Georgia and 1 other state had the highest population of Marick families in 1840.

What did your Marick 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Laborer and Housekeeper were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Marick. 44% of Marick men worked as a Laborer and 19% of Marick women worked as a Housekeeper. Some less common occupations for Americans named Marick were Machinist and Maid. .
